    I found these instructions on volvo-forums, give it a shot:

    Make sure key is in and turned to accessory position so the radio wil have power available, then

    With radio off, press and hold the source button.
    Then, press and release the Volume/on/off button.
    Continue holding the source button.
    In a few seconds the Equalizer Menu will appear.

    Press the source button to change which frequency you want to adjust and turn the source button the adjust how much you want to boost or cut a particular frequency.

    To save your settings, simply turn off the radio.

    Hint: Turn your fader control to full front while adjusting the front speakers and then to full back while adjusting the back speakers. Makes it easier the hear your EQ changes.
